Wondering if it possible to use Most Recent Cost as costing method. Presently using Moving Average. Most Recent Cost does not seem to be available.

Most Recent Cost is not available, and it couldn't be.

Say, for example, you buy one part at $10 and then a day later the same part at $12. The total value is $22. The most recent cost is $12. What if you sold them both at the same time. If you used MRC as the costing method, the cost would be $24, which is more than the total value.
